You sure about that?? I read in a Honda Tuning mag that said that the H22 and Accord downpipes are the same length. I don't think they are interchangeable though.
They dropped in an H22 into a 94 Accord and they said that they did not have to do any modifications to the cat or cat-back system to make it work.

even with the length not being an issue, the flanges dont line up, if u were to have a muffler shop cut off the stock flange and put a lude exhaust mani flange on it i guess u may get it to work, but why??? just pay $50 and get the downpipe from wherever u got ur swap, or just go ahead and get an aftermarket header right now (not dc)
